Cardano Price Drops as Dijkstra Hard Fork Roadmap Unveiled

Cardano's (ADA) price has dropped to $0.175 after a 1.03% decline in response to the network's announcement of its two-phase Dijkstra hard fork development schedule.

The roadmap outlines significant protocol enhancements planned for late 2026 and the second quarter of 2027.

Phase one, scheduled for Q4 2026, will implement Ouroboros Linear Leios, introduce Nested Transactions, and incorporate Script Context capabilities in PlutusV4.

The subsequent phase, projected for Q2 2027, will activate Ouroboros Peras, which aims to enhance transaction confirmation speeds and reduce settlement times across the blockchain.
